Methana

Methana is a unique volcanic peninsula in the Saronic Gulf, often considered an island as it's connected to the Peloponnese by only a narrow strip of land. Known as one of Greece's most fascinating geological wonders, Methana is home to over 30 volcanic craters, healing thermal springs, dramatic lava landscapes, and authentic Greek villages — making it a hidden gem just two hours from Athens.

The Volcano of Methana

Part of the South Aegean Volcanic Arc (along with Santorini and Nisyros), the Methana volcano last erupted in 230 BC, an eruption documented by the ancient writers Pausanias, Ovid, and Strabo. Today, visitors can hike the well-marked trail starting from the picturesque village of Kameni Chora, walking through pine forests and over solidified lava flows to reach the main crater — an unforgettable adventure with breathtaking views of the Saronic Gulf and Aegina island.

Healing Thermal Springs

Methana has been famous since ancient times for its therapeutic sulfuric thermal springs. The Baths of Pausanias, named after the ancient traveler who described them, contain some of the world's richest concentrations of silicic acid and have been visited for healing for over 2,500 years. The springs are particularly known for treating skin conditions, arthritis, and gynecological issues.

Things to Do in Methana

Hike the Volcano – A 4 km moderate hike from Kameni Chora to the volcanic crater through stunning lava landscapes.

Explore Cave Peristeri – Discover this mysterious underground cave with its hidden lake.

Visit Kameni Chora Village – A traditional volcanic village with stone houses, narrow streets, and pine forests.

Soak in the Thermal Springs – Enjoy the healing waters at the Baths of Pausanias and other natural hot springs.

Discover Vathi & Agios Georgios – Charming coastal villages with seaside tavernas serving fresh seafood.

Walk on Agioi Anargyroi Islet – A small green islet connected to Methana by a strip of land, perfect for romantic sunset walks among ancient ruins.

E-Bike Tours – Explore Methana's dramatic volcanic landscapes on guided e-bike tours.

Day Cruise & Tours to Methana

Methana can be reached by ferry from Piraeus (about 2 hours) and is also accessible from neighboring islands like Poros, Aegina, and Hydra. Many Saronic Gulf cruises and private tours include Methana as a stop, combining volcano hiking with beach time and thermal spring relaxation.
